Understanding Insulation

Insulation plays a crucial role in maintaining comfortable indoor temperatures by reducing the transfer of heat between the inside and outside of our homes. It acts as a barrier, preventing hot air from entering our homes during the summer and keeping warm air inside during the cooler months.

There are several types of insulation materials commonly used in Florida homes. Fiberglass insulation is one of the most popular choices due to its affordability and effectiveness. It consists of fine glass fibers that trap air, creating a layer of insulation. Cellulose insulation, made from recycled paper products, is another common option. It is environmentally friendly and offers excellent thermal performance. Lastly, spray foam insulation provides an airtight seal and is known for its superior insulation properties.

Benefits of Insulation Installation

The benefits of insulation installation are numerous and can have a significant impact on both your energy bills and overall comfort in your home.

First and foremost, insulation installation can result in substantial savings on your energy bills.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, homeowners can save up to 20% on heating and cooling costs by properly insulating their homes. In Florida, where air conditioning is a necessity for most of the year, these savings can be even more significant.

In addition to cost savings, insulation installation also improves indoor comfort. By reducing heat transfer, insulation helps maintain a consistent temperature throughout your home, eliminating hot spots and cold drafts. This means you can enjoy a comfortable living environment without constantly adjusting the thermostat.

Step-by-Step Guide to Insulation Installation

Here is a step-by-step guide to the insulation installation process:

  1. Assessment: A professional insulation installation service will assess your home to identify areas of heat loss and determine the appropriate insulation materials and levels.
  2. Preparation: Before installation, the area to be insulated should be cleaned and cleared of any obstacles.
  3. Air Sealing: Air leaks can significantly impact the effectiveness of insulation. Sealing any gaps, cracks, or openings with caulk or weatherstripping is an essential step in the installation process.
  4. Insulation Installation: The chosen insulation material will be installed in the designated areas, such as the attic, walls, or crawl spaces. The insulation will be evenly distributed to ensure optimal coverage.
  5. Ventilation: Proper ventilation is crucial to prevent moisture buildup and maintain indoor air quality. The insulation installation service will ensure that your home has adequate ventilation to complement the insulation.
  6. Final Inspection: Once the insulation installation is complete, a final inspection will be conducted to ensure that everything is in order and meets the necessary standards.

Improper insulation in homes can pose potential health risks. Insufficient insulation can lead to heat loss, resulting in cold indoor temperatures during winter months. This can contribute to increased incidences of respiratory illnesses, such as asthma and bronchitis, particularly among vulnerable populations like children and the elderly. 

Inadequate insulation also allows for air leaks, which can lead to moisture buildup and mold growth. Exposure to mold spores has been associated with various health issues, including allergies, respiratory infections, and exacerbation of existing respiratory conditions. Additionally, improper insulation may not effectively prevent the infiltration of outdoor pollutants into the home, potentially compromising indoor air quality and further impacting occupants' health. Therefore, it is crucial to ensure proper insulation installation in order to mitigate these potential health risks associated with inadequate home insulation.

When determining the appropriate R-value for insulation in a home, several factors need to be considered. The first factor is the climate of the region, which affects the amount of heat transfer through the building envelope. In Florida, where hot and humid weather prevails, it is important to select insulation materials with higher R-values to prevent unwanted heat gain. Another consideration is the type of construction and design of the house. Factors such as wall thickness, roof design, and window quality can influence the insulation requirements.

Additionally, energy efficiency goals and budget constraints should be taken into account when deciding on an appropriate R-value. Lastly, it is crucial to follow proper installation techniques and guidelines to ensure optimal performance of the insulation system. Overall, determining the appropriate R-value involves evaluating climate conditions, building characteristics, energy efficiency objectives, and installation processes in order to effectively reduce energy consumption and maintain thermal comfort within a Florida home.
